Transaction 25106ccc6eb04a006a6ada24ebae43b594294e7184a3d933c5692feea4cdcb8d

1 Input
2 Outputs
  • 25106ccc6eb04a006a6ada24ebae43b594294e7184a3d933c5692feea4cdcb8d:0
  • value  52401
    address  1848TjYEuFACNZ4N36PJrvrmW6XdB2dEpB
  • 25106ccc6eb04a006a6ada24ebae43b594294e7184a3d933c5692feea4cdcb8d:1
  • value  269720
    address  3ExxKTgXKrKYUfSwxbejiAfua2yhUcDshN